By automatically installing a dependent app, even if the dependent app is not targeted to the user or device, Intune will install the app on the device to satisfy the dependency before installing your Win32 app. It's important to note that a dependency can have recursive sub-dependencies, and each sub-dependency will be installed before installing the main dependency. You can view the dependency installation failure by clicking on a failure (or warning) provided in the Win 32 app installation details., Each dependency will adhere to Intune Win32 app retry logic (try to install 3 times after waiting for 5 minutes) and the global re-evaluation schedule. Also, dependencies are only applicable at the time of installing the Win32 app on the device.
